Executive Summary
What is the Cirqon Power Solutions corporate platform? It is a high-performance, Next.js-powered B2B lead generation engine built by BengalTech Solutions for one of Bangladesh's premier industrial electrical engineering firms.
Client: Cirqon Power Solutions, specializing in 33kV commercial receiving substations and utility-scale Solar PV EPC plants.
Challenge: Despite their 100% incident-free safety record and deep technical expertise, their digital presence lacked the performance and SEO capabilities required to capture high-value corporate inquiries.
Solution: BengalTech engineered a bespoke corporate platform using Next.js, combining sub-second load times with a premium, mission-critical engineering aesthetic and targeted B2B lead routing.
Outcome: Delivered a 40% increase in organic B2B inquiries, 120% boost in organic search visibility, and perfectly scored 100/100 Core Web Vitals.

Development Process
- Frontend: Built with Next.js App Router for Static Site Generation (SSG), ensuring service pages load instantly.
- Backend/APIs: Developed secure Node.js APIs utilizing Nodemailer to instantly route B2B consultation requests to the correct engineering department.
- Integrations: Deployed a floating WhatsApp Business API widget, allowing procurement teams to instantly contact site engineers.
- Analytics: Integrated an automated analytics pipeline using GA4 and Google Search Console to track exact B2B search terms generating leads.
- Deployment: Hosted on Vercel for global edge caching, ensuring the site remains highly available and blazingly fast.
